Abstract

<P>PROBLEM TO BE SOLVED: To provide a bolt supporting metal fitting to a channel material capable of easily hooking a bolt to the inside of a lip of the channel material with no special work with the bolt to be connected to the channel material. <P>SOLUTION: The bolt supporting metal fitting is attached to the head B1 of a bolt B, and is hooked inside the lip C1 of the channel material. The bolt B is inserted in an insert hole 1A which hooks with the head B1 of the bolt B, and the head B1 of the bolt B is forcedly pinched by a pinching part 2A for fixing the head B1. The bold supporting metal fitting forms an U shape in cross section with a band-like locking piece 1 with the insert hole 1A opened and a pair of engagement pieces 2 which are bent and extended from both ends of the width of the locking piece 1, to engage with the head B1 of the bolt B. The engagement piece 2 is provided with the pinching part 2A. <P>COPYRIGHT: (C)2005,JPO&NCIPI

[0001]
BACKGROUND OF THE INVENTION
The present invention relates to a bolt support metal fitting for a channel material used when, for example, an instrument or the like is mounted on a channel material, or when the channel material is mounted on an H-shaped steel or an I-shaped steel.
[0002]
[Prior art]
When mounting fixtures such as lighting fixtures on the channel material, bolts are mounted on the channel material, and the lighting fixture is fixed with the bolts. On the other hand, when the channel material is mounted on the H-shaped steel or the I-shaped steel, the clamp mounted on the shaped steel and the channel material are connected by bolts. In this way, when using the channel material, the bolt uses a locking nut that locks to the opening of the channel material, or a locking portion that locks to the opening is provided on the head of the bolt. Special bolts are used.
[0003]
The mounting bracket described in Patent Document 1 is used when a lighting fixture or the like is mounted on a channel material. A special locking portion is fixed to the head of the bolt, and this locking portion is used as a channel material opening. This is a mounting bracket that is locked to the inside of the lip portion. This locking part is locked inside the lip part by rotating the locking part by 90 ° after being inserted into the channel material from the opening of the channel material.
[0004]
On the other hand, the support metal fitting described in Patent Document 2 is a metal fitting used when the channel material is suspended from the suspension bolt, and is a support provided to fix the locking nut inside the lip portion of the channel material. It is a metal fitting. In this support bracket, a holding piece for holding the locking nut from below is provided, and the stepping locking piece provided on the holding piece is fixed to the lip portion of the channel material, so that the locking nut is attached to the lip portion. It can be fixed to.
[0005]
Each of the support brackets is a support bracket previously proposed by the applicant of the present application, and has been devised so as to improve workability in the operation of connecting the bolt to the opening of the channel material.

[Problems to be solved by the invention]
According to Patent Document 1 and Patent Document 2 described above, it has succeeded in improving workability when a bolt is connected to the opening of the channel material. However, in Patent Document 1, a locking piece is attached to the head of the bolt. Since fixing is required, there is a disadvantage that the manufacturing cost is higher than that of a normal bolt.
[0008]
Moreover, in the support metal fitting described in Patent Document 2, processing to the side of the suspension bolt is not particularly required. However, since it is necessary to attach a locking nut to the lip portion C1 of the channel material C in advance, Compared with the support metal fitting, there is a disadvantage that much work is required for fixing the stepped locking piece of the holding piece to the lip portion.
[0009]
Therefore, the present invention was created to solve the above-mentioned problems, and it is not necessary to perform special processing on the bolt to be connected to the channel material, and the bolt can be easily placed inside the lip portion of the channel material. It is an object of the present invention to provide a bolt support metal fitting to the channel material that can be locked to the frame.

DETAILED DESCRIPTION OF THE INVENTION
Hereinafter, embodiments of the present invention will be described in detail with reference to the drawings. The main structure of the support bracket of the present invention has a substantially U-shaped cross section composed of a locking piece 1 and a pair of fitting pieces 2 (see FIG. 1).
[0016]
The locking piece 1 has a substantially band shape, and has an insertion hole 1 </ b> A in the longitudinal center. The insertion hole 1A is for inserting a bolt B connected to the channel material C, and is formed with a diameter to be locked to the head B1 of the bolt B (see FIG. 3). The illustrated bolt B is a hexagonal bolt that is normally used, but a square bolt or the like can also be used.
[0017]
The fitting piece 2 is bent and extended from both width ends of the locking piece 1, and is provided so that the head B <b> 1 of the bolt B is fitted between the locking pieces 1. The entire length of the support bracket of the present invention constituted by the locking piece 1 and the fitting piece 2 is inserted into the channel material C from the opening of the channel material C, and is rotated inside the channel material so that the channel material is The length is set so as to be locked inside the lip C1. In the example of illustration, the notch 1B for rotation is provided in the corner | angular part which the longitudinal both ends of the latching piece 1 oppose (refer FIG. 2). This is provided so that when the locking piece 1 is rotated 90 ° in the direction of the notch for rotation 1B, both end portions of the locking piece 1 abut against the inner surface of the channel material C and cannot be rotated any further. (See FIG. 3). By providing in this way, the position of the support bracket of the present invention inserted into the channel material C can be locked in an optimum state, and the mounting work of the bolt B via the support bracket of the present invention is extremely difficult. It is something that makes it easy.
[0018]
The fitting piece 2 is provided with a clamping portion 2A for forcibly clamping the head B1 of the bolt B and fixing the head B1. The sandwiching portion 2A is for fixing the support bracket of the present invention to the head B1 of the bolt B fitted between the fitting pieces 2, and the head B1 of the bolt B is inserted into the insertion hole 1A of the locking piece 1. When the lower surface is locked, it is provided at a position to be locked to the upper surface of the head B1 (see FIGS. 4 and 6).
[0019]
The sandwiching portion 2A shown in FIG. 4 shows dot-like locking projections 2Aa that project from the opposing inner surfaces of the fitting piece 2, respectively. By forcibly pressing the bolt head B1 in the direction of the locking piece 1 from the position of the locking protrusion 2Aa, the locking protrusion 2Aa prevents the bolt head B1 from coming off. Therefore, the clamping part 2A needs to be set to a clamping force that can push the head B1 with fingers. The locking projection 2Aa can be easily formed by embossing with a press die.
[0020]
5A and 6B show linear locking projections 2Ab that project from the opposing inner side surfaces of the fitting piece 2, respectively. By forcibly pressing the bolt head B1 in the direction of the locking piece 1 from the position of the locking protrusion 2Ab, the locking protrusion 2Ab prevents the bolt head B1 from coming off. The locking projection 2Ab can be formed by press working along the longitudinal side surface of the fitting piece 2. It is also possible to form the fitting piece 2 by bending it.
[0021]
In the illustrated example, the bolt B is locked with the opening of the channel material C facing downward, but the direction of the channel material C is not limited to the illustrated example. Moreover, the use is wide-ranging, such as attaching a lighting fixture or the like to the channel material C with the bolt B using the support bracket of the present invention, or attaching the channel material C to the shape steel.
